When a seller makes a counter-offer what is the essence of such an action?

Business
1 answer:
GrogVix [38]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The correct answer is The seller rejects the buyer's offer.

Explanation:

A counter offer more often than not expresses that the seller will acknowledge the buyer's offer. Generally, the seller is dismissing the buyer's unique offer by making a counter offer.

One thought on the issue of offer and acknowledgment is whether the offer or counteroffer was in truth acknowledged before its expiration. A counteroffer is a dismissal and another offer.  

A seller who is in receipt of an offer from a buyer can't at first counteroffer, and if that fails to work, then accept the original offer. This is so in light of the fact that, by law, a counteroffer is a dismissal of the main offer and the creation of another offer. The old offer from the buyer is dismissed and "gone" as of the creation of a counteroffer by the seller.

In this economy, community members typically use simple tools to plant and harvest crops. Food supplies are supplemented by hunt
dsp73

Answer:

Traditional economy.

Explanation:

A traditional economy is one that relies on historical methods, customs, and beliefs to develop. It is generally more common in developing countries because it is an economy based on rural activities such as agriculture, fishing and hunting. Because it is an economy that develops around a tribe or a family, it is customary for production to be for consumption only, so there is no surplus and little money movement.
